Undamaged, uncut copies are extremely rare. Most copies were destroyed by children as they completed the many activities (cut-outs, etc.) offered. Post's Cereals 3 Ring Circus was a promotional activity comic with only one actual comic page, "From Jungle to Circus," as told by Jim Rogers, animal trainer. It was distributed in 1946 by General Foods Corporation. Full color, all newsprint, 32 pages, 6-1/4-in. x 8-1/4-in, no cover price.

Volume 7 - 1st printing. "Salvation!" Collects Preacher (1995-2000) #41-50.
Written by Garth Ennis. Art by Steve Dillon. Painted cover by Glenn Fabry.
Jesse Custer becomes the sheriff of a troubled Texas town. As Jesse confronts twisted local businessman Odin Quincannon - known as 'the Meatman' - the local chapter of the Ku Klux Klan and a town whose inhabitants include a former Nazi spy and a woman who just happens to be Jesse's long-lost mother, he confronts the demons of his past, recommits himself to his search for God, and learns more about his father as he prepares to return to the life he left behind. This collection includes a cover gallery and reprints of issue #50's pin-ups of the Preacher cast by Jim Lee, Fabry, Tim Bradstreet, John McCrea, Joe Quesada and Jimmy Palmiotti, Doug Mahnke, and Kieron Dwyer.
Softcover, 256 pages, full color. Mature Readers

Published Oct 1985 by Charlton Comics Group.$2.50
Cover by Wayne Howard. Stories and art by Tom Sutton, Joe Staton, Nicola Cuti and Wayne Howard. Professor Cyrus Coffin and his niece Arachne relate horror stories, featuring art by Wally Wood protege Wayne Howard. An empty grave desires a body, in a story with art by horror comics legend Tom Sutton. Nathan marries an heiress with sinister intentions, in a story by E-Man co-creators Nicola Cuti and Joe Staton. In another Cuti tale, a couple raids the secret tomb of Ku-Tot-Mon in search of treasure. The frantic veterinarian on the cover is named "Dr. Weirtham," obviously a reference to horror-comics foe Dr. Fredric Wertham. The Class of 86; Tomb It May Concern; Never Is a Long Time; Grave Story; The Exorcism. 32 pages, Full Color. Cover price $0.75.
